Abstract
Investigations of Lake Balaton by the Geological Institute of Hungary started in 1981. Between 1987 and 1989 within the framework of Cuban–Hungarian cooperation a total of 373 km boomer seismic section was registered covering the entire lake in a quasi uniform network. As a result of the profiles’ evaluation a picture was drown up about the spatial distribution of lacustrine sediments, the mud structure as well as the variable morphology and geological setting, till 30 m depth from the lake bottom. During 2003 and 2004, in the cooperation of Geophysical and Geological Institutes the original thermo-paper records were digitally archived, re-evaluated and the recent records were integrated as well. The re-evaluation gave the opportunity for a more detailed spatial determination of the geological structure of the bed (layers, faults). This gave an opportunity to plan the research of Pleistocene sediments, deposited before the lake formation.
